Understanding What is Online Learning
Online learning, also known as distance education, is a method of education that utilizes digital technologies to deliver course materials and facilitate interactive learning experiences. It allows students to access educational content, participate in discussions, submit assignments, and take exams from anywhere with an internet connection. Online learning can range from individual online courses to full degree programs, offering a wide range of subjects and disciplines. It provides a flexible and convenient alternative to traditional classroom-based learning, making education more accessible to a diverse range of learners.
The History and Myth of Online Learning
The concept of online learning dates back several decades, with the first online courses being offered in the 1990s. Initially, online learning was met with skepticism and viewed as a less credible form of education compared to traditional on-campus learning. However, advancements in technology and changes in societal attitudes towards online education have led to its widespread acceptance and recognition. Today, online learning is a well-established and respected mode of education, with numerous reputable universities and colleges offering online courses and degree programs.

Tips for Success in Earning College Credits Online
While earning college credits online can be a rewarding experience, it also requires self-discipline and effective time management. Here are some tips to help you succeed in your online education journey:
- Create a schedule and stick to it. Set aside dedicated study time each day or week.
- Stay organized by keeping track of assignments, deadlines, and course materials.
- Participate actively in online discussions to enhance your learning and engage with fellow students and professors.
- Seek help when needed. Utilize online resources, virtual libraries, and academic support services.
- Take breaks and practice self-care to maintain focus and prevent burnout.

Exploring How to Earn College Credits Online
When it comes to earning college credits online, there are several pathways to consider. You can enroll in individual online courses to supplement your existing education or pursue a full degree program entirely online. Additionally, some traditional universities offer hybrid programs that combine online and in-person learning experiences. It's important to research and choose the pathway that aligns with your educational goals, learning style, and personal preferences.
